131,708,525,256 is an even composite number composed of seven prime numbers multiplied together.

What does the number 131708525256 look like?

This visualization shows the relationship between its 7 prime factors (large circles) and 768 divisors.

131708525256 is an even composite number. It is composed of seven dist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of seven hundred sixty-eight divisors.

Prime factorization of 131708525256:

23 × 35 × 7 × 11 × 47 × 97 × 193

(2 × 2 × 2 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 7 × 11 × 47 × 97 × 193)
